项目摘要
The Canadian population is ageing. In 2010, an estimated 4.8 million Canadians were 65 years of age or older. By 2051, about one in four Canadians are expected to be of age 65 years or older. With such a significant bias towards an ageing population in Canada, an enormous amount of resources need to be devoted to the services to cater for the elderly. This proposal is based on the premise that living in their own home increases the quality of life of elderly, increases the options for caregivers and reduces the pressure on health-care resources. This program of research aims to provide a lower-cost, smart home monitoring solution that will reduce the risk of an unattended emergency. Proposed research will advance the state of the art in using video, depth, motion and audio sensors to determine the state of well-being of occupants within the monitored home.
To achieve this goal, on short-term this proposal will a) develop algorithms for integrating data from multiple video and depth cameras and obtain accurate and consistent estimates of location, identity and pose of an individual, b) develop a physics-based model to estimate pose from video and depth cameras in real-time and c) develop tracking algorithms that can incorporate location, identity and pose information together with data motion and audio sensors. On the long term, this proposal will investigate use of passive infra-red cameras for estimating vital signs, develop an action recognition system and create a full-size prototype for validating the algorithms. This research will also develop a comprehensive security model for data access as well as develop privacy guidelines and auditing mechanisms to ensure that privacy and security requirements are met.
By achieving the short and long term objectives, it is expected to make a significant contribution to the area of activity recognition. Such advances, when combined with the focus on elderly monitoring will yield significant engineering solutions to a looming problem that is sure to consume significant national resources in the coming decades.
